look up any word, like the eiffel tower:
is a way of describing the most beautiful woman you've ever known.
Chen: that your wife? ... damn she's hot.

Omar: yup, that's my Tasnia ;)
by hagoonunu January 17, 2011
An adjective similar to the word cool.
Girl #1: HEYYYY, check out my T-SHIRT.
Girl #2: Now that is just tasnia.
by Automatic Eyes June 11, 2009